Not that I don't believe in freedom to marry but, why do gay people equate being denied the same rights as str8 married couples have to marriage? You have the same rights under the law in civil unions...no?

NO -- we don't. First off, there is no federally recognized gay marriage or civil union in the USA. Therefore, equal rights are not afforded to cross-national couples. Personally, I couldn't care less if they call it marriage or not -- but that begs the question -- WHY SHOULD IT MATTER? Equal respect under the law should be available to people of all ages, races, religions, sexual orientation or gender.
